- Disambiguation notice
- #1 Richard Lane 1926-2002, Images from the Floating World.
#2 Richard J. Lane 1966-, lecturer in postcolonial theory, drama, and literature at South Bank University; Jean Baudrillard.
#3 Richard J. Lane, certified teacher and fight director, Society of American Fight Directors; Swashbuckling
#4 Richard Lane 1947-2008, Last Stand at Le Paradis.
#5 Richard Lane 1918-, The golden age of Australian radio drama, 1923-1960.
#6 Richard Lane, Prisoner, Cell Block H.
#7 Richard Grenville Williams Lane 1905-1982, one of the founders of Penguin Books
#8 Richard "Dick" Lane 1899-1982, US actor and sports announcer.
